Hey, welcome to the forum!User_4 wrote:I was able to lay a better bead using 1/8 6013 electrodes (for which my machine is not rated to melt), than I could with these 6011's. This is leading me to consider the possibility that the electrodes are no good?
When you say "better bead" do you mean a visually more appealing bead? 6011 rods are characterized as "fast freeze" rods, meaning the weld puddle changes from liquid to solid quickly. They tend to leave a rougher, choppier looking bead.
Some electrodes can go bad because their flux coating can pick up moisture from the air. 7018 electrodes, for instance, absorb moisture easily due to the composition of their flux coating, but 6011 is not prone to this. If your 6011s are fairly new, not rusty, and the flux coating is not flaking or chipping off, they should be ok.
